Customization and flexibility
The best quilting subscription box often offers a welcome level of customization and flexibility, allowing users to tailor their experience to personal preferences. Many services provide the ability to choose or skip projects each month, giving you control over what materials and designs you receive, which can be especially helpful if you want to focus on specific quilting skills or styles.
Options for fabric type preferences are commonly available, so whether you prefer cotton, batik, or novelty prints, you can select a subscription that aligns with your tastes. For those considering gifts, several subscription boxes also offer gift subscription availability, making it a thoughtful present for friends or family who enjoy quilting. This flexibility allows you to enjoy new quilting challenges without feeling locked into a rigid plan, adapting the box contents to fit your creative needs and schedule.
Subscription plans and pricing
Choosing the best quilting subscription box involves understanding the cost per box and the overall value offered through materials, patterns, and extras. Prices can vary depending on the quality of fabric, the number of items included, and any bonus content provided to enhance the quilting experience.
Options typically include monthly subscriptions that provide fresh projects each month or quarterly plans that bundle more extensive materials for larger undertakings. Cancellation policies are generally flexible, allowing one to stop the subscription without penalties before the next billing cycle, while renewal policies often default to automatic continuation unless actively canceled. This setup makes it easy to tailor the subscription to current crafting needs and budget, ensuring a rewarding experience without unexpected commitments.

Skill level and project complexity
Finding the best quilting subscription box often depends on how comfortable you feel with quilting projects and the amount of time you want to dedicate to each one. Subscription boxes that cater to beginners usually offer step-by-step instructions and tutorials that break down the processes into manageable steps, making it easier to learn new techniques without feeling overwhelmed.
On the other hand, boxes aimed at those with more experience might include larger, more intricate projects that challenge your skills and encourage creativity. When choosing a box, it’s helpful to consider how detailed the instructions are and whether the project sizes fit your available leisure time.
Selecting a subscription that matches your proficiency and desired project scope will make quilting more enjoyable and help you develop your skills steadily.
